19:56:58 #startmeeting 19:56:58 Meeting started Wed Apr 22 19:56:58 2015 UTC. The chair is TheSnide. Information about MeetBot at http://wiki.debian.org/MeetBot. 19:56:58 Useful Commands: #action #agreed #help #info #idea #link #topic. 19:57:29 well... this meeting might be fast. 19:57:43 nothing much happened here. anyone ? 19:57:47 #topic misc 19:58:15 I'm planning to work on sparklines soon! 19:58:21 Do you have any idea about how to handle this? 19:58:39 I opened an issue on GitHub (444) https://github.com/munin-monitoring/munin/issues/444 19:59:14 json config ? 19:59:42 (That was just an example,) 19:59:47 i'd better have it munin-like. 20:00:02 No problem, as long as someone sends it to the templates ;P 20:00:13 as, let the plugin tell how to aggregate themselves 20:00:37 http://munin-monitoring.org/wiki/protocol-aggregation would be a good starting poin 20:03:10 Nice doc, haven't read it yet 20:03:15 *bookmark* 20:05:00 A cpu sparkline next to each host would be great! I haven't thought about it 20:05:35 (load*) 20:07:33 I've started API design and done some tinkering on a re-implementation of the munin master, using the Mojolicious and Minion modules. 20:08:07 Also, some UI issues has been fixed (plugin names are shown now), but some remains to be fixed: some links seems to be broken, we have to find a solution for this 20:08:33 I don't know if blind relative links can work, neither if we can generate absolute ones before sending those to the templates 20:09:04 chteuchteu: is there a ticket describing which link types work or not, and how to reproduce? 20:09:50 There are several actually. But I don't think that everything is summed up in one place. I'll do that 20:11:06 chteuchteu: you can rely on / being munin 20:11:21 That will be easier! But still 20:12:05 as, with httpd we have a *whole* server for us. 20:12:14 Since there can be several levels for each plugin (I don't know where I read this, but it seems that it can be Group > Node > eth > eth0 20:12:28 and group can be group1/group2… 20:12:36 Wow, didn't knew that 20:12:43 having it as my_apache_server/munin/ is to be handled at the reverse proxy level. 20:13:06 But I think that we'll be able to fix some of the broken links thanks to this rule! 20:13:08 TheSnide: makes absolute links fun :) 20:13:09 chteuchteu: groups can be infinitely nested. 20:13:18 Didn't knew that, thanks! 20:13:27 ssm: oh, no absolute links please. 20:13:31 :D 20:13:44 ... at least not more than "/my/absolute/path" 20:14:29 no more "../../../i/want/to/go/elsewhere/" madness either, please 20:14:42 just use "/i/want/to/go/elsewhere/" 20:14:57 When possible! Some links will have to be generated before being sent to the template 20:15:20 if you need more VARS in the template please say so. 20:15:22 As soon as it includes groups or nodes I think (I can't guess if there are one or more groups from HTML) 20:15:57 we are passed the template compatibility anyway. 20:16:14 ? 20:16:18 (which was a nice goal to have, but was too restrictive) 20:16:34 --> that you can use devel .tmpl in stable-2.0 20:16:50 and alternative .tmpl from stable-2.0 in devel. 20:17:17 ... but #1 we don't have that much alternate templates. and #2 the new templates are soo much cooler anyway :D 20:17:47 Oh ok! 20:17:54 the most advanced ones where the "quake" one and the "munstrap" one. 20:18:14 which are mostly merged and enhanced in the main one by now. 20:20:46 Also, I'll try to learn Pearl programming to be able to help sending data to templates :) 20:23:32 Alright, I already fixed one of the links (the one on the header logo). That was the easiest one 20:31:07 :) 20:31:23 anyway... EBEDTIME for me. 20:32:11 #endmeeting